Sei Investments Intrinsic Value – SEI ($NASDAQ:SEIC) Investments Company is a publicly traded financial services firm based in Oaks, Pennsylvania. The company provides asset management, investment processing, and investment operations solutions to institutions, financial advisors, and private clients. Recently, one of the company’s insiders has sold their shares in the company. Insiders are individuals who have access to private information about the company due to their roles within the company, such as company executives or board members. Their share sales are closely monitored as they are seen as a potential indicator of the company’s future performance.
When an insider sells their shares of SEI Investments Company, it usually signals that they have no faith in the company’s future prospects. The sale could possibly be an indication of weak prospects for SEI’s stock, which could cause investors to become wary of the company and subsequently drive down the stock price of SEI Investments Company. Investors should always be vigilant when it comes to monitoring insider buying and selling activity of a company’s shares. While insider selling can be an indication of impending trouble for a company, it is important to note that it could also be due to personal reasons such as diversifying a portfolio and not necessarily indicative of the company’s performance. Therefore, it is advisable to conduct further research if one sees an insider selling shares of SEI Investments Company.

On Thursday, SEI Investments Company (SEI) saw a dip in its stock price as investors took note of increased insider selling. Despite the majority of news coverage being positive, SEI’s stock opened at $63.3 and closed at $62.7, down by 1.2% from the previous closing price of $63.4. This development has caused some concern for investors, who are now wondering if SEI is a good investment in the current market. Peers
The company’s clients include financial institutions, corporations, and high-net-worth individuals. SEI Investments Co. operates in three segments: Investment Management, Investment Processing, and Investment Operations. SEI Investments Co. competes with Vontobel Holding AG, Ninety One PLC, and CI Financial Corp. These companies also provide investment management, investment processing, and investment operations solutions to their clients.
– Vontobel Holding AG ($OTCPK:VONHF)
As of 2022, Vontobel Holding AG has a market cap of 3.11B. The company is a financial services provider that offers a range of services, including asset management, private banking, and investment banking.
– Ninety One PLC ($LSE:N91)
Ninety One PLC is a publicly traded company with a market capitalization of 1.63 billion as of 2022. The company has a Return on Equity of 66.37%. Ninety One PLC is engaged in the business of providing investment management services. The company offers a range of services including asset management, investment advisory, and private wealth management.
– CI Financial Corp ($TSX:CIX)
CI Financial Corp is a wealth management company headquartered in Toronto, Canada. As of 2021, it had $208 billion in assets under management and administration, and over 2,000 employees. The company offers a range of financial services and products, including asset management, investment banking, insurance, and mortgages.
